EP 1 — Beachbody's Marc Suidan on Why Questioning Everything Leads to Better Business Outcomes

In our first episode of the Smarter Sourcing podcast, recorded at the ICR Conference, John speaks with Marc Suidan, CFO at The Beachbody Company, a health and fitness company. They discuss Marc's career evolution to CFO, what drew him to Beachbody, and how Beachbody functions as an organization — including its centralized procurement process for its nutrition arm. They also discuss the practices that make a company agile and fast-moving, how to leverage customer data for better decision-making, and the three initiatives that are propelling Beachbody into the future.

Topics discussed:

  • The fundamentals of The Beachbody Company, how it functions, and why Marc was drawn to become its CFO.
  • How tracking customer behavior is easier through a streaming platform and how Beachbody uses data to drive better outcomes.
  • How the centralized procurement process for Beachbody's nutrition arm works.
  • Why the threat of cyber attack keeps Marc up at night.
  • The common practices that make companies more agile, fast-moving, and successful.
  • The three initiatives Beachbody has focused on for its transformation.
  • The challenges a connected fitness company faces in terms of manufacturing, inventory, and shipping versus one with just a streaming platform.
